Weight from garmin connect

This sounds way too much of a hassle for regular readings. I do blood pressure readings and weigh ins right after the HRV reading every morning. Then I get dressed and off to work. By the time I’m sitting in the train, the Garmin->Intervals sync is done, and I trigger this python script on my server (using an SSH Client on my phone)

I published the python script on GitHub. You’d have to register an app on withings (which is free and as far as I remember instant, so no waiting for anyone to check it) and have some machine (I use one of my linux servers) to run the python script on (right now I do it manually, once garmin synced all the wellness data, but in the future I’m planning to run this completely automated at a specified time every day)

Feel free to ask if anything is unclear, or can be improved.

happy holidays

4 Likes